A mental health care provider in Greater London is seeking Trainee/Newly Qualified Counsellors to offer both remote and face-to-face therapy. The ideal candidates will have Level 4 BACP approved Counselling Training and be members of BACP/UKCP. They will be supported by a dedicated Clinical Leadership Team and enjoy competitive pay rates. This role offers flexibility with the autonomy to manage your own diary, empowering therapists to work on a secure platform catering to clients across the UK.
